comparemela.com
Home
Live Updates
Body cam footage reveals troopers discovery of 20+ undocumented immigrants : comparemela.com
Body cam footage reveals troopers' discovery of 20+ undocumented immigrants
Newly released body camera footage from the Department of Public Safety shows troopers stepping in to handle a dangerous situation yesterday.
Related Keywords
Mexico
,
Guatemala
,
Sergeant Erick Estrada
,
Investigation Division
,
Department Of Public Safety
,
Texas Department Of Public Safety
,
Public Safety
,
North Laredo
,
Erick Estrada
,
Texas Department
,
Border Patrol
,
comparemela.com © 2020. All Rights Reserved.